Industry Landscape

The influencer marketing industry is experiencing rapid growth, driven by increased social media usage and a desire for authentic brand communication. Brands are investing heavily in influencer campaigns to reach diverse audiences and drive engagement. Technological advancements, such as AI-powered influencer platforms, are enhancing campaign efficiency and measurement. However, challenges remain, including maintaining transparency, ensuring brand safety, and adapting to evolving social media algorithms.

Emerging Technologies

AI-Powered Influencer Platforms

AI-driven influencer platforms streamline influencer discovery, campaign management, and performance analysis, enhancing efficiency and ROI.

AR/VR Integration

AR/VR technologies create immersive brand experiences, allowing influencers to engage audiences in novel and interactive ways.

Blockchain for Transparency

Blockchain technology ensures transparency and trust in influencer marketing by verifying influencer authenticity and tracking campaign performance securely.

Impactful Policy Frameworks

FTC Endorsement Guidelines

The Federal Trade Commission (FTC) Endorsement Guidelines require that endorsements and testimonials in advertising be truthful and not misleading (latest update 2023).

Requires clear and conspicuous disclosures of sponsored content, impacting how Billion Dollar Boy structures and manages influencer campaigns to ensure compliance.

California Consumer Privacy Act (CCPA)

The California Consumer Privacy Act (CCPA) grants California consumers various rights regarding their personal data, including the right to know, the right to delete, and the right to opt-out of the sale of their personal information (2018).

Influences data collection and usage practices, requiring Billion Dollar Boy to implement stricter data protection measures when managing influencer and consumer data.

Children's Online Privacy Protection Act (COPPA)

The Children's Online Privacy Protection Act (COPPA) imposes certain requirements on operators of websites or online services directed to children under 13 years old regarding their collection, use, and disclosure of personal information (1998).

Affects how Billion Dollar Boy handles children's data in influencer campaigns, necessitating extra precautions to ensure compliance when targeting younger audiences.
